Explanation

We can solve the given question using the trigonometric function below.

[tex]\tan \theta=\frac{\text{opposite}}{adjacent}[/tex]

In the triangle, x represents the adjacent side while 10 represents the opposite side. The given angle is also 50 degrees.

Therefore, we will have;

[tex]\begin{gathered} \tan 50^0=\frac{10}{x} \\ \text{Cross mutiply} \\ x\tan 50^0=10 \\ \therefore x=\frac{10}{\tan 50^0} \end{gathered}[/tex]

Hence, by comparison, we can get the values of a and b.

Answer

[tex]a=10;b=50^0[/tex]
